Performs routine and complex analytical procedures, recognizes deviations and provides interpretation following established standards and practices.

ACCOUNTABILITIES
1. Performs testing
a. Maintains established hospital and departmental policies and procedures. Complies with requirements of accreditation and regulatory agencies.
b. Process biological specimens for analysis. Evaluate and solves problems related to specimen collection and processing.
c. Performs routine and complex analytical procedures, recognizes deviations, and provides interpretation.
d. Operates instruments and performs procedures within the scope of training.
2. Maintenance
a. Performs scheduled maintenance procedures.
b. Recognizes equipment malfunctions and acts according to established protocols.
3. Quality Control
a. Performs, records, and maintains accurate quality control records. Recognizes out of control results and takes appropriate actions.
4. Knowledge Resource
a. Answers inquiries regarding results and factors affecting results. Acts as a liaison and fosters effective communication between laboratory and health care team, maintaining patient confidentiality.
5. Computer System
a. Performs routine inquiry and data input on the laboratory computer systems.
b. Ensures accuracy of information in the computer systems and is responsible for corrective actions.
c. Utilizes computer software to enhance specialty area.
6. Training/Competency Assessment
a. Instructs new associates and students as required.
b. With respect to experience and education, assesses competencies of other test performers.
7. Continuing Education
a. Must complete required number of CE units
b. Must complete mandatory in-services
c. Maintains and upgrades personal professional development.
8. Team Leader
a. Provides guidance to co-workers in the absence of an on-site Supervisor regarding staffing and technical issues that arise.
9. Other duties as assigned.

Job Requirements

Education: Doctoral, Master's or Bachelor's degree in a chemical, physical, biological or clinical laboratory science or medical technology from an accredited institution or transcripts showing 60 semester hours from an accredited institution indicating 24 semester hours of medical technology courses or 24 semester hours of science courses that include 6 semester hours in chemistry, 6 semester hours of biology, and 12 semester hours of chemistry, biology, or medical technology in any combination OR meet an alternate qualification route for Testing Personnel for High Complexity Testing as detailed in §[click to reveal phone number]493.1489
Years of Experience: Completion of a clinical laboratory training program approved or accredited by the ABHES, the CAHEA, or other organization approved by HHS OR meet an alternate experience route for High Complexity Testing Personnel as detailed in §[click to reveal phone number]493.1489 .
Certification: American Society of Pathology (ASCP) MLS or Categorical eligible at time of hire with certification achieved within one year of hire.

WORKING CONDITIONS
Personal Protective Equipment: Lab Coat, Gloves, Protective Eyewear, as required.
Physical Demands: Must be able to move continuously about hospital and between workstations; and prolonged periods of standing. Must be able to tolerate exposure to disease bearing specimens, odorous chemicals, carcinogens, mutagens, low-level radiation, electrical hazards, and flammable liquids. Must be able to differentiate colors. Must be able to move, lift or carry materials weighing up to 50 lbs., 5% of the time. May have to stand continuously for the entire shift. Must be able to input and retrieve information from computer.
